Output 84ef2594602c9114af7e87cba56d9e281f0fe248de5a09e21e1c5a9a207263f7:0

value
62232366
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3222ac26d3eb8ffea4b734e6d356f950a03b51c OP_EQUALVERIFY OP_CHECKSIG
address
1LFNWShLsf66j7vLy7Pm7UoySa8f1FcpRC
transaction
84ef2594602c9114af7e87cba56d9e281f0fe248de5a09e21e1c5a9a207263f7
spent
true